Russian language. Russian [e] is an East Slavic language, spoken primarily in Russia. It is the native language of the Russians and belongs to the Indo-European language family. It is one of four living East Slavic languages, [f] and is also a part of the larger Balto-Slavic languages.

3 de abr. de 2024 · The Russian language is the principal state and cultural language of Russia. Russian is the primary language of the majority of people in Russia. It is also used as a second language in other former republics of the Soviet Union. It belongs to the eastern branch of the Slavic family of languages.

Russian is an Eastern Slavic language spoken mainly in Russia and many other countries by about 260 million people, 150 million of whom are native speakers. Russian is an official language in Russian, Belarus, Kazakhstan and Kyrgyzstan, and in a number of other countries, territories and international organisations, including Tajikistan ...
Oficialidad. El ruso es la lengua oficial de Rusia y una de las lenguas oficiales de Bielorrusia, Kazajistán y Kirguistán, siendo cooficial también en los territorios en disputa de Abjasia, Osetia del Sur, Transnistria y Nueva Rusia . Es uno de los seis idiomas oficiales de las Naciones Unidas. 4 .
